nCino (NASDAQ:NCNO -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 26th. The company reported $0.22 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.14 by $0.08. The business had revenue of $148.82 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$143.17 million. nCino had a positive return on equity of 1.18% and a negative net margin of 5.86%.The business's quarterly revenue was up 12.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.14 earnings per share. nCino has set its FY 2026 guidance at 0.770-0.800 EPS. Q3 2026 guidance at 0.200-0.21 EPS. On average, analysts expect that nCino will post 0.12 EPS for the current year.

nCino Company Profile

nCino, Inc, a software-as-a-service company, provides cloud-based software applications to financial institutions in the United States and internationally. Its nCino Bank Operating System connects financial institution employees, clients and third parties on a single cloud-based platform which include client onboarding, deposit account opening, loan origination, end-to-end mortgage suite, and powerful ecosystem.
